As Massarutto notes, it’s not exactly a secret that a full sequel to Assetto Corsa is in development right now. It’s slated to arrive in 2024, and although there’s not much information on it right now, the Kunos founder was able to share a couple of details.

While the team did investigate Unreal Engine 5 as a potential basis for AC2 — with UE4 underpinning ACC — it will instead be using its own newly developed engine, just as it did with AC originally.

That’s not due to any particular problems with UE5, just that KS wants to use its own tools to allow it to do what it wants. In fact Massarutto points out that “Kunos Simulazioni is not a gaming studio, it’s much more a technology provider, and ‘accidentally’ we also make racing games”!
